Change the following sentence into passive voice. "Kamala loves Mini".

AMini loved Kamala

BMini is loved by Kamala

CMini loves Kamala

DMini is loving Kamala

Answer:

B. Mini is loved by Kamala

Read Explanation:

In the active voice sentence "Kamala loves Mini", "Kamala" is the subject who performs the action "loves" on "Mini", which is the object of the sentence. To convert this sentence into passive voice, we make the object "Mini" the subject of the sentence, and use the past participle form of the verb "love", which is "loved", along with the auxiliary verb "is" to form the passive voice. Therefore, "Mini is loved by Kamala" is the passive voice form of the sentence "Kamala loves Mini".
